Composite doors have gained tremendous appeal in the last few years due to their outstanding resilience, aesthetic appeal, and energy effectiveness. Unlike traditional wooden doors, composite doors are made from a mix of products, usually combining wood, PVC, and glass-reinforced plastic. While they provide numerous benefits, composite doors are not immune to wear and tear, weather obstacles, and unintentional damage. Understanding how to repair them is necessary for homeowners aiming to preserve their door's functionality and look gradually.
Typical Problems Faced by Composite Doors
Despite their robust building, composite doors might come across several concerns. Here are some of the most frequently reported problems:
1. Misalignment
Composite doors can become misaligned over time due to modifications in humidity, temperature level changes, or faulty installation. This misalignment can cause issues with closing and locking the door appropriately.
2. Scratches and Dents
Composite doors can establish cosmetic damage from unintentional bumps, scrapes, or excessive wear. While this does not affect performance, it can significantly affect the door's look.
3. Locking Mechanism Failure
As a vital component of any door, the locking mechanism may wear or breakdown over time. This can compromise the door's security and availability.
4. Sealant Wear
The weather seals around composite doors might deteriorate, leading to drafts and reduced energy effectiveness. A used seal can likewise cause water leakages.
5. Paint and Finish Damage
The paint or finish on composite doors can peel, fade, or chip, diminishing the door's look as well as its protective qualities.
Repair Techniques for Composite Doors
Fixing a composite door often includes particular strategies customized to the type of damage encountered. Below are some reliable approaches to attend to the common problems pointed out above:
1. Resolving MisalignmentInspect Hinges: Inspect the door hinges for wear or damage. Tighten up screws as required or replace hinges if they are malfunctioning.Change the Striker Plate: If the door isn't closing effectively, change the striker plate to align with the lock latch.Shimming: If the door is sagging, consider shimming the hinges to lift the door back into positioning.2. Repairing Scratches and DentsUsage Composite Repair Kits: These sets normally include fillers that can be used to scratches and dents. When repaired, you can sand and paint over the area to mix it with the remainder of the door.Repaint or Refinish: If the damage is comprehensive, repainting or refinishing the door might be necessary for an uniform look.3. Repairing the Locking MechanismLubrication: Often, the primary step is to apply lube to the locking system to guarantee it moves freely.Replacement: If lubrication doesn't fix the concern, consider replacing the lock cylinder or the entire hardware setup.4. Replacing Weather SealsEliminate Old Seals: Carefully eliminate the worn or damaged seal from the frame.Set Up New Weather Stripping: Cut the brand-new seal to size and adhere it appropriately, guaranteeing it fits comfortably against the door.5. Retouching Paint and FinishRepaint: For little chips and scratches, retouch with the exact same color paint utilized initially. How much do composite door repairs generally cost?
The cost of repairs can differ greatly based upon the degree of damage and the area where you live. Small repairs, like scratches or misalignment, might only cost a couple of dollars in products, while significant repairs, such as changing locking mechanisms or entire areas of the door, might vary from ₤ 100 to over ₤ 500.

3. How frequently should I carry out maintenance on my composite door?
It's advisable to check and preserve composite doors a minimum of when a year. This consists of checks on seals, locks, hinges, and the door's total appearance.
4. What is the life-span of a composite door?
Composite doors can last between 30 to 50 years with proper care and maintenance, considerably outlasting conventional wooden doors.
